CRANIO-CEREBRAL

An Illustrated Encyclopedic Medical Dictionary · 1892 · p. 19
adj. Kran-i2-o-se2r'e2-bra2l. For deriv., see CRANIUM and CEREBRUM. Fr.. cranio-cerebral. Pertaining to both the cranium and the cerebrum (said of the art of finding the points on the cranium which correspond to certain regions of the brain lying directly beneath), [a, 18.] ["Arch, of Med.," viii, 1882, p. 260 (a, 18); " Ctrlbl. f. Chir.," Oct. 27, 1888, p. 791 (a, 18).] [s. 434]
